**PURPOSE OF THE POSITION:**
As a Coordinator Crew Resources, you will work with Trainmen, Switchmen, Engineers, and Yardmasters to ensure they are given appropriate work assignments while ensuring timely and cost\-effective deployment of crews to meet operational requirements.
**POSITION ACCOUNTABILITIES:**
* Call train and engine crews to work in accordance with collective bargaining agreement
* Process reports and maintain computerized crew board through documentation of seniority moves vacancies, personal leave and vacations
* Make business decisions based on priorities established by the Operations Centre (OC)
* Maintain Crew Management Application records
* Monitor Train \& Engine (T\&E) maximum hour clock and mandatory time on duty and rest rules
* Accountable for the proficient handling of other related tasks as required
